Urban gardening holds tremendous value for numerous reasons. It brings forth environmental benefits such as boosted air high quality, reduced metropolitan heat island impact, and stormwater runoff mitigation. It contributes to food safety and self-sufficiency by promoting neighborhood food manufacturing and making sure access to nutritious fruit and vegetables. Lastly, metropolitan gardening fosters area involvement and social cohesion, producing shared eco-friendly spaces and instilling a feeling of belonging and pride amongst locals.

Involving urban kids in expanding their food can assist teach them a useful lesson about how it is grown. A well-planned city garden can help with decreasing rain overflow and flooding in city neighborhoods by decreasing the number of impervious surfaces that can't soak up rainwater. As a result of the metropolitan warmth island impact, cities are normally hotter than bordering locations.

Area yards are semi-public spaces shared by a community of neighbors and various other individuals where they jointly take part in expanding fruits, veggies, or blossoms, sharing labor and harvest. It's fantastic to get included in these sustainable projects as they're similarly helpful for you, the area, and the setting. Area gardens are discovered in communities, however can likewise be developed in colleges, residential lands, or organizations, such as medical facilities.
